The city jumps at Goose Gossage park. Lots of guys go there so you can meet up with some locals to show you around to a few hidden spots
Google maps search: W Garden of the Gods Rd & Mark Dabling Blvd
Colorado Springs, CO
go south on mark dabling ~1/4 mile - you'll see em on the left.
